The radio code for a 2008 Honda Element is typically found in the owner's manual or on a card that may have been included with the manual. If you can't find it, you can retrieve the code by contacting a Honda dealer, providing your vehicle's VIN, and the radio's serial number. The serial number can usually be found by removing the radio from the dashboard or by checking the radio display if it prompts for a code.
